Tomato, Luther H - Seeds
Solanum lycopersicum
Early hybrid cherry tomato, tall and indeterminate, disease-resistant and highly productive. It produces 20-25 g fruits, dark cherry-coloured outside and red inside, which ripen almost at the same time and can be harvested in trusses. Suitable for greenhouse and outdoor cultivation.
An early, tall (indeterminate), disease-resistant, high-yielding hybrid variety, suitable for greenhouse and outdoor cultivation. Fruits weigh 20–25 g, are deep cherry-coloured on the outside and red inside. They remain intact for a long time without cracking or falling off the clusters. Each cluster produces 12 tomatoes. Peas ripen almost simultaneously, can be picked in trusses.
Temperature of the seeding substrate should be at least +21–26 °C, room temperature should be at least +23 °C. When 2–4 true leaves show up, seedlings are transplanted one by one to the permanent place. Sow 15–20% more seeds than the intended number of seedlings.
10 seeds are sufficient for a 5–7 m² area or 5–7 pots, planting one plant per pot.
